Aiteo Cup: Akwa Utd to face Rangers in Q/F after defeat to Nasarawa Utd

Defending champions Akwa United will battle Enugu Rangers in the quarter final of the Aiteo Cup after suffering a 2-0 defeat to Nasarawa United in their last Group game in Aba to finish as runners up with six points from three games.

A goal in each half by Nojeem Olukokun and Isah Ndala helped Nasarawa United to a comfortable win and move them to top of Group D with 7 points from three matches.

Coach Abdu Maikaba whose team booked their place in the quarter final early in the week following Victories over Wikki Tourists and Kogi United, made eight changes to the team that won the previous two games as they slump to their first defeat in the competition.

The Champions fell behind on the stroke of half time when Nojeem Olukokun capitalised on a defensive mix up to put his team in front. The Lafia based team extended their lead in the 70th minute through Isah Ndala who benefitted from a sloppy defending to secure his team’s victory.

Akwa United with fourteen goals in their previous four matches also had chances of their own but Cyril Olisema, Etboy Akpan and Paul Obata all fail to put them away as they fail to score for the first time in five matches.

The Promise Keepers who are aiming to retain the trophy they won last year will travel to Kano to engage Enugu Rangers next Wednesday at the Sani Abacha Stadium for one of the four semi final tickets while Nasarawa United will remain in Aba to confront El-Kanemi Warriors of Maiduguri.
